Output 277553afb306d2c79a2043108489387be121d9a0fecfb6d4e1570da1a3efd9ca:6

value
28018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af81be9b1717bd493a37399e91ffc8c909e528ae OP_EQUAL
address
3Hh1bvXgCF46XK3oqRPSyevE766GprD38i
transaction
277553afb306d2c79a2043108489387be121d9a0fecfb6d4e1570da1a3efd9ca
spent
true